We're really not this naive, right?

No one got tossed into the mix randomly. Whichever school(s) told reporters that they didn't apply to the Big 12 was lying about or denying what they did. That's actually what most schools used to do when asked about conference realignment. It's just that this particular Big 12 process is so open that a lot of schools are on the record about applying compared to the past.

I do think its pretty safe to say all 10 AAC (who have all been public) and Arkansas St. and NIU asked to be put in and are being discussed. Rice, UNM, BYU and CSU have been public about it. So that leaves Air Force, UNLV, SDSU and Boise who might not actually be in the mix.
